Bug#427680: RFH: moc -- ncurses based console audio player



Package: wnpp
Severity: normal

I request assistance with maintaining the moc package.

The package description is:
 moc (music on console) is a full-screen player designed to be powerful
 and easy to use.
 .
 Supported file formats are: MP3, OGG Vorbis, FLAC, WAVE, SPEEX, Musepack (MPC),
 AIFF, AU, WMA (and other less popular formats supported by libsndfile).
 New formats support is under development.
 .
 Other features: simple mixer, colour themes, searching the menu (the playlist
 or a directory) like M-s in Midnight Commander, the way MOC creates titles
 from tags is configurable, optional character set conversion for file tags
 using iconv(), OSS or ALSA output.
 .
  Homepage: http://moc.daper.net

As reported in #427473, with no response yet, I want to build moc
against new libflac-dev. Configuring the source gives:

...
checking for libFLAC... yes
ERROR: ld.so: object 'libfakeroot-sysv.so' from LD_PRELOAD cannot be preloaded: ignored.
ERROR: ld.so: object 'libfakeroot-sysv.so' from LD_PRELOAD cannot be preloaded: ignored.
ERROR: ld.so: object 'libfakeroot-sysv.so' from LD_PRELOAD cannot be preloaded: ignored.
...

This is shown on a pbuild as well. Configuring against libflac-dev
1.1.2 gives no ERROR.  Any way, the package builds fine with
libflac-dev 1.1.4, but I don't want to upload with the above config
ERROR.

Is someone out there to give me a hint?
